Fairly large driveway that was stained with years of dirt, mold, grease and oil. Cleaned with a detergent application and surface cleaner. Bay Area Pressure Washing
Hi Jason, I know this is a older video. What solution did you use for Pre-treat? Did you have any line showing after you finish the job with the surface cleaner? If so did you post treat?
We used a 10/1 sh mix as a pretreat, then we surfaced cleaned and then post treated with the same mix. There are times we have lines after wards but the post treat has always help with that for us.

Hi. Qhen you say 10 to 1 is that 10 gallons of bleach 1 gallon of water? Thanks
No, it’s 10 gallons of water to 1 gallon of 12.5% SH. Driveways don’t need a strong mix, it’s just to help break down some of the stuff on it.
